Hebrew-English Dictionary

Strongs: H310
Hebrew: אַחַר
Transliteration: ʼachar
Pronunciation: akh-ar'
Part of Speech: Adverb Preposition-Conjunction
Bible Usage: after ({that} {-ward}) {again} {at} away {from} back ({from} {-side}) {behind} {beside} {by} follow ({after} {-ing}) {forasmuch} {from} {hereafter} hinder {end} + out (over) {live} + {persecute} {posterity} {pursuing} {remnant} {seeing} {since} thence {[-forth]} {when} with.
Definition:  

properly the hind part; generally used as an adverb or {conjugation} after (in various senses)

1. after the following part, behind (of place), hinder, afterwards (of time)

a. as an adverb

1. behind (of place)

2. afterwards (of time)

b. as a preposition

1. behind, after (of place)

2. after (of time)

3. besides

c. as a conjunction

d. after that

e. as a substantive

1. hinder part

f. with other prepositions

1. from behind

2. from following after
